The village of Kirkmichael offers essential amenities, including a shop and café, and is conveniently situated 12 miles from both Blairgowrie and Pitlochry. These nearby towns boast various attractions, such as theatres, salmon viewing points, and seasonal events like the Enchanted Forest and the Caledonian Etape cycling event.
Outdoor enthusiasts will find Kirkmichael a walker’s paradise, with over 10 miles of waymarked paths and access to the Cateran Trail, a scenic 64-mile circular route. The surrounding area is rich in wildlife, with opportunities to spot red squirrels, deer, and various bird species, enhancing the natural experience.
